Output 8a288545051da9b6bec87393b01d9e2311530fbf29ce357e0bf712412e65c332:1

value
3100446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ecbffc5ae275bf8cf187546b2d6a766855c01bc OP_EQUAL
address
38sf1cX1anVEd1Hxg5msgTUiJ7smUdgUiG
transaction
8a288545051da9b6bec87393b01d9e2311530fbf29ce357e0bf712412e65c332
spent
true